Submit-AzHDInsightScriptAction
Odešle novou akci skriptu do clusteru Azure HDInsight.
Syntaxe
Submit-AzHDInsightScriptAction
[-ClusterName] <String>
[-Name] <String>
[-Uri] <Uri>
[-NodeTypes] <RuntimeScriptActionClusterNodeType[]>
[[-Parameters] <String>]
[[-ApplicationName] <String>]
[-PersistOnSuccess]
[-ResourceGroupName <String>]
[-DefaultProfile <IAzureContextContainer>]
[<CommonParameters>]
Description
Rutina Submit-AzHDInsightScriptAction odešle novou akci skriptu do clusteru Azure HDInsight. Pomocí PersistOnSuccess spusťte akci skriptu při každém vertikálním navýšení kapacity clusteru, pokud bude akce skriptu zpočátku úspěšná.
Příklady
Příklad 1: Odeslání nové akce skriptu do spuštěného clusteru HDInsight
Submit-AzHDInsightScriptAction `
-ClusterName "your-hadoop-001" `
-Name "scriptaction" `
-Uri "<script action URI>" `
-NodeTypes Worker -PersistOnSuccess
Tento příkaz odešle akci skriptu do spuštěného clusteru HDInsight.
Parametry
-ApplicationName
Určuje název aplikace pro akci skriptu. Pokud zadáte applicationName, PersistOnSuccess musí být nastavená na Hodnotu False, uzly musí obsahovat pouze hraniční uzel a počet akcí skriptu by měl být roven 1.
Typ: | String |
Position: | 5 |
Default value: | None |
Vyžadováno: | False |
Přijmout vstup kanálu: | True |
Přijmout zástupné znaky: | False |
-ClusterName
Určuje název clusteru.
Typ: | String |
Position: | 0 |
Default value: | None |
Vyžadováno: | True |
Přijmout vstup kanálu: | False |
Přijmout zástupné znaky: | False |
-DefaultProfile
Přihlašovací údaje, účet, tenant a předplatné používané ke komunikaci s Azure
Typ: | IAzureContextContainer |
Aliasy: | AzContext, AzureRmContext, AzureCredential |
Position: | Named |
Default value: | None |
Vyžadováno: | False |
Přijmout vstup kanálu: | False |
Přijmout zástupné znaky: | False |
-Name
Určuje název akce skriptu.
Typ: | String |
Position: | 1 |
Default value: | None |
Vyžadováno: | True |
Přijmout vstup kanálu: | True |
Přijmout zástupné znaky: | False |
-NodeTypes
Určuje typy uzlů, na kterých se má spustit akce skriptu.
Typ: | RuntimeScriptActionClusterNodeType[] |
Přípustné hodnoty: | HeadNode, WorkerNode, ZookeeperNode, EdgeNode |
Position: | 3 |
Default value: | None |
Vyžadováno: | True |
Přijmout vstup kanálu: | True |
Přijmout zástupné znaky: | False |
-Parameters
Určuje parametry akce skriptu.
Typ: | String |
Position: | 4 |
Default value: | None |
Vyžadováno: | False |
Přijmout vstup kanálu: | True |
Přijmout zástupné znaky: | False |
-PersistOnSuccess
Označuje, že akce skriptu by se měla spustit při každém vertikálním navýšení kapacity clusteru. Tento parametr přepínače se ignoruje, pokud akce skriptu zpočátku selže.
Typ: | SwitchParameter |
Position: | 6 |
Default value: | None |
Vyžadováno: | False |
Přijmout vstup kanálu: | False |
Přijmout zástupné znaky: | False |
-ResourceGroupName
Určuje název skupiny prostředků.
Typ: | String |
Position: | Named |
Default value: | None |
Vyžadováno: | False |
Přijmout vstup kanálu: | False |
Přijmout zástupné znaky: | False |
-Uri
Určuje veřejný identifikátor URI pro akci skriptu (skript PowerShellu nebo Bash).
Typ: | Uri |
Position: | 2 |
Default value: | None |
Vyžadováno: | True |
Přijmout vstup kanálu: | True |
Přijmout zástupné znaky: | False |
Vstupy
Výstupy
Související odkazy
Azure PowerShell